Filters:
Country:
Region:
City:
Similar words:
transmission shop in Bromley North Station
About 34 results.
Urbanik Motorcycles Ltd
99-100 Ravenscourt Place, W6 0UN London, United KingdomHigh quality motorcycle & scooter workshop based in Hammersmith. Reasonable prices, friendly and experienced staff, quick repair times.
Euro Car Parts, Croydon
Horatius Way, CR0 4RU Croydon, United KingdomClick here to find important information about Euro Car Parts in Croydon, selling a range of cheap car parts. Find contact details, opening times and more